About King of Dragon Pass

A unique mix of RPG and strategy: everything in King of Dragon Pass is about choice and control.

Create your own epic saga of survival, mythology and diplomacy! Rule your clan, make strategic decisions that affect the game world, win battles and expand your influence in this unique mix of RPG, strategy and story-telling.

Set in Glorantha, this acclaimed title blends interactive stories and resource management. Navigate a captivating world shared by games such as RuneQuest, HeroQuest, 13th Age and Six Ages. Advisors with distinctive personalities help you rule your clan and bear the consequences of your decisions.

Immensely replayable, thanks to nearly 600 interactive scenes with all hand-drawn illustrations. Short episodes and automatic saving mean you can play even when you have a minute or two.

Not recommended Jul 6, 2026
The game poses as a fun adventure of managing your tribe, but it turns out to be Excel spreadsheet simulator... except you can't see the numbers. It's a strategy game where numbers matter the most, yes. Which normally wouldn't be a problem. But here you won't see these numbers, you won't see your chances, and you have to guess why you failed. With such a bad game design idea, I don't even know how this game earned enough money to provide for sequel. Doesn't matter if you pick the easiest difficulty, if the RNG is bad, the gods don't look favorably at you or sth, you won't save your clan unless you know what you're doing. And you won't at the start. Because the tutorial is ♥♥♥♥. Many mechanics are so obscure and poorly explained that you won't know how to manage them unless you spend hundreds of hours on trials-and-errors, or digging through walkthroughs and wikis. What strikes me positively, though, is how the game forces you to educate yourself the world lore in order to make correct decisions, especially in the case of hero quests. You can't just brute-force them. You have to know how would your hero act in the myth. I have never seen such idea in a game.

Not recommended May 29, 2026
I'm sure there's a great game in there somewhere but I found it marred heavily by poor UI and UX. It took me a while just to figure out that I could change my leaders and how to do so and accept them. There's no real hints as to whether any of your resource spends are totally inadequate, ok, etc.. I suspect it would strongly benefit from fewer options or "pick for me" in easy modes. Good example are the heroquests which apparently have difficulties but no way apart from wrecking your game/failing to begin to tell them apart. If you have LOTS of time to old school explore and redo and redo and redo maybe it's your thing. Probably if I had spent time reading through "how to play" videos it would be different - but after a few days of trying in my limited spare time, I just find it frustrating and feel lost. For example, I have no idea about trade, what should or shouldn't, how much to "sacrifice" on mysteries (at all), and when retaliating on a raid we wiped the floor with them (we had literally ZERO losses and there were major losses on their part) yet somehow despite massively smashing them and losing absolutely ZERO we were deemed as the loser and now my tribe is angry?
